Inorganic compounds can enter water from several sources, including agricultural runoff, where fertilizers and pesticides leach into waterways. Industrial discharges often release heavy metals and other pollutants into rivers and lakes. Urban runoff, carrying contaminants from roads and buildings, contributes additional inorganic materials. Lastly, wastewater treatment plants can also discharge inorganic substances if not properly treated.

Inorganic compounds dissolve in water due to the water's polar nature. Water molecules attract and surround the ions or molecules of the inorganic compound, causing them to break apart. This process, called hydration, allows the individual components of the inorganic compound to be dispersed throughout the water.

In general, inorganic compounds will dissolve in polar or inorganic solvents such as water, whereas organic compounds will dissolve in organic solvents. However there are many exceptions to these.
